Output 752e4dcc29dd642cfa9da4578c17e1003400142af77d3f66d8b154a11eb8807b:11

value
100190322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bc5b2eb1ff660aa69a3b297881020fc0fdc86e2 OP_EQUAL
address
MKBcBPKrWMgtFmrV4Mycs9kKr7cyuP4wbs
transaction
752e4dcc29dd642cfa9da4578c17e1003400142af77d3f66d8b154a11eb8807b
spent
true